Samaila Dalhat, a former member of the House of Representatives who represented the Kankia/Ingawa/Kusada Federal Constituency of Katsina State, has died.
Dalhat’s death was confirmed by political stakeholders in Katsina State on Wednesday, August 19, 2026.
However, details about the cause of his death were not immediately available.
Dalhat served as a federal lawmaker representing the constituency in the National Assembly.
His death has attracted condolences from political figures, associates and residents of Katsina State.
